A Hummer H3X airbag control unit can suffer from various defects that impair the functionality of the safety system. The most common problems include crash data stored after an accident, internal error codes, or communication problems.
After an impact, the airbag control unit stores so-called crash data. This data blocks the system, even if there is no physical damage to the unit, and must be properly erased so that the airbag warning light goes out and the system is fully functional again.
Internal faults in the control unit can be indicated by permanently illuminated airbag warning lights even when an accident has not occurred. Such faults can be caused by aging components, voltage fluctuations, or moisture and require precise diagnosis and repair of the Hummer H3X airbag control unit.
Sometimes the airbag control unit also experiences communication problems with other modules in the vehicle's network. This can lead to unreliable error codes or the failure of the airbag function.
